📄 charts.pas
字号:
unit Charts;
interface
uses
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ms,
Dialogs, StdCtrls, ComCtrls, Buttons, ExtCtrls, TeeProcs, TeEngine,
Chart, DbChart, Series, DB, ADODB, TeeFunci, Theme;
type
TFrm_Chart = class(TForm)
GroupBox1: TGroupBox;
Label1: TLabel;
Label2: TLabel;
DateTimePicker1: TDateTimePicker;
DateTimePicker2: TDateTimePicker;
SpeedButton1: TSpeedButton;
PageControl1: TPageControl;
TabSheet1: TTabSheet;
ADOPice: TADODataSet;
DSPice: TDataSource;
DBChart1: TDBChart;
Series1: TBarSeries;
procedure SpeedButton1Click(Sender: TObject);
procedure FormClose(Sender: TObject; var Action: TCloseAction);
private
{ Private declarations }
public
{ Public declarations }
end;
var
Frm_Chart: TFrm_Chart;
implementation
uses Main,DM;
{$R *.dfm}
procedure TFrm_Chart.SpeedButton1Click(Sender: TObject);
var
SQLStr:string;
begin
SQLStr:='select sum(MR_Pict_Tab.MR_PicT) as 价格总数,(select Count (MR_Name) from MR_Buyer_Tab) as 客户数量 from MR_Pict_Tab,MR_Buyer_Tab '+
' Where MR_Pict_Tab.MR_ClientID=MR_Buyer_Tab.MR_ID and MR_Buyer_Tab.MR_Date>=#'+DateToStr(DateTimePicker1.DateTime)+
'# and MR_Buyer_Tab.MR_Date<=#'+DateToStr(DateTimePicker2.DateTime)+'#';
ADOPice.Close;
ADOPice.CommandText:=SQLStr;
ADOPice.Open;
end;
procedure TFrm_Chart.FormClose(Sender: TObject; var Action: TCloseAction);
begin
Action:=caFree;
ActiveForm:=nil;
end;
end.
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-